Week 6

Week 6 is just about over.

What a full week of Family Violence.

We took the Arrest, Search, and Seizure Exam on Wednesday night. I made a 91 and finally passed the General Orders test as well.

ACT is starting to get into the fun groud and pound stuff, I can feel it.

Had another PRT test on Monday as well. Ran a 10:31 mile and half, not bad for weighing 255.

Had class officer elections as well. I was voted by the class to be the Drill Instructor. Hope I lead proudly.

Still at 99. The group is bonding more each week.
